For a couple of weeks or so now, BBC Four has been running a new promo for itself with the strapline 'Colour. Contrast. Extra Brightness.'

http://www.theidentgallery.com/misc/misc/BBC4-CCEB-1.jpg

This week has seen a couple of presentation tweaks too. In line with BBC One and Two, the channel's logo is now unboxed and centred on trailers. Even the trailer above has had the treatment:

And the endboards for trailers have been changed as well. (Myself, I never liked the radiating gradient. These are far superior.)
